Transaction 42478101d5e7be90f376e5077f97e7cee6b795c35279b72af1521d8378676433
1 Input
1 Output
-
42478101d5e7be90f376e5077f97e7cee6b795c35279b72af1521d8378676433:0
- value
- 529880
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daf8b2c969bae0e39f1a79fb773dd2a0b320b82
- address
- bc1qhkhcktyknwhquw03570mwu7a9g9nyzuzhy3e0u